Capacity and Power Needs
I first calculated how much power I actually needed. A 100Ah battery can provide different amounts of usable energy depending on the voltage. For example, a 12V 100Ah battery gives me around 1,200Wh of energy, which is enough for many small to medium applications. I always recommend matching the battery capacity to the devices I plan to run.
Battery Life and Cycle Count
One of the biggest reasons I preferred lithium ion was the long cycle life. Compared to lead-acid batteries, lithium batteries usually last much longer. I looked for a battery with a high number of charge cycles because that means I can use it for years without replacing it too soon. This gave me better long-term value.
Weight and Portability
I noticed that lithium ion batteries are much lighter than traditional batteries of the same capacity. This made a big difference for me, especially when I needed something for an RV or portable solar setup. If I had to move or install the battery myself, the lighter weight made the process much easier.
Charging Speed and Efficiency
I also paid attention to how quickly the battery could charge. Lithium ion batteries usually charge faster and waste less energy than older battery types. This helped me save time and get more efficient performance from my solar panels and chargers. I found this especially useful when I needed power ready quickly.
Safety Features I Considered
Safety was very important to me. I looked for a battery with a built-in BMS, which helps protect against overcharging, over-discharging, short circuits, and overheating. This feature gave me peace of mind, especially when using the battery for home backup or outdoor setups.
